- Paprika's origin can be traced back to the Americas, but it gained prominence when it was introduced to Spain and Hungary, where it became a cornerstone of their culinary traditions. Hungarian paprika, in particular, is globally renowned for its rich flavor and heat levels that range from mild to fiery.

Aleppo chili powder has a milder heat level than hot paprika. I will describe it as a middle ground between cayenne pepper powder and spicy paprika. Thus, it's a good substitute for paprika if you want to tone down the spiciness and heat of your recipe.

When Christopher Columbus landed in the Bahamas in 1492, he was the first European to have an encounter with any sort of chile pepper plant. He brought the ancestor of all paprika back with him to Europe and specifically to his patrons, the Spanish monarchs Ferdinand and Isabella. The king and queen did not care for their fiery heat and sent them to a monastery to be studied. These monks sent them further along across Spain and Portugal. From there, chile peppers made their way across Europe. Some peppers stayed spicy, like those in Calabria, but other European cultures experimented with their breeding and created the sweet and flavorful varieties of peppers that give us paprika today.

One thing that you might need to pay attention to is how hot red pepper flakes are. Unlike paprika, you can't find mild, medium, and hot varieties of crushed red pepper flakes.
Hungarian Paprika is often found in casseroles, white cheeses, chili, egg dishes, marinades, rubs, salads, stews and it also goes well with most vegetables, pork and rice dishes.
